This is a cold-climate zone, deeper frost lines mean lines have to be buried further down, adding to the excavation cost of sewer line replacement. Ask your contractor to confirm the local frost-line depth before you compare bids.

The install method matters as much as the length. Trenchless (pipe bursting or lining) costs more per foot but spares your yard, driveway, and landscaping; traditional open-trench digging is cheaper per foot but tears up the surface.

Traditional open-trench digPer foot; lowest per-foot cost but full surface restoration$300 $400
Trenchless pipe lining (CIPP)Per foot; cures a liner inside the old pipe, minimal digging$350 $500
Trenchless pipe burstingPer foot; pulls a new pipe through, breaking the old one$300 $450

When to replace

Signs you need sewer line replacement in Loveland

  • Recurring drain clogs and backups across multiple fixtures
  • Sewage smell in the yard or around floor drains
  • Soggy, sunken, or unusually green patches in the lawn (sewage leak)
  • Multiple slow drains throughout the house at once
  • Gurgling toilets or drains when other fixtures run
  • Tree-root intrusion confirmed on a camera inspection
  • Old clay, cast-iron, or Orangeburg (tar-paper) sewer pipe
Decision

Repair or replace in Loveland?

Start with a camera inspection: a single localized break can be spot-repaired or lined, but widespread root intrusion, bellies, or collapsed sections call for full replacement.

Repair if…

  • Damage is one isolated crack or offset joint
  • The rest of the line is structurally sound on camera
  • A spot repair or partial trenchless lining can reach it

Replace if…

  • The line is clay, cast iron, or Orangeburg and failing
  • There are multiple breaks, bellies, or root intrusions
  • A section has collapsed or sagged (recurring backups)
  • Repeated rooter/jetting visits aren't holding the problem

Enter the run length (most home laterals are 40–100 ft, house to street). Per-foot ranges are localized to Loveland, CO labor.

MethodPer footTotal (60 ft)
Open-trench (dig & replace)
Traditional dig-up. Cheapest per foot but adds surface restoration (lawn, driveway, patio).
$50–$124$2,950$7,450
Pipe bursting (trenchless)
Pulls a new pipe through the old one via two access pits — minimal digging.
$59–$198$3,550$11,900
CIPP lining (cure-in-place)
A resin liner cured inside the existing pipe. No trench, but the pipe must be intact enough to line.
$79–$248$4,750$14,850

Add surface restoration for open-trench (concrete/driveway $2–$25/sq ft) and permits where a run crosses into the public right-of-way. Per-foot ranges are national benchmarks localized to Loveland, CO labor — a research estimate, not a quote.

Sewer lines and repipes don't come with a sticker price — the installation method and the condition of the ground move the number more than any material choice.

The diagnosis-first case

Pricing a sewer or repipe off a hunch invites two bad outcomes: paying to replace pipe that's fine, or missing the section that's actually collapsed. A camera run through the line settles the question before a single dollar is committed.

The method case

Compare the two methods on the finished bill, not the excavation quote. Trenchless costs more to install yet skips restoring everything a trench destroys, while a conventional dig looks cheap right up until you price setting the yard right again.

The material case

PEX is cheaper, faster and freeze-tolerant; copper costs more but lasts longer and some buyers prefer it. Match the material to your climate and how long you'll own the home.

Our take

The number one rule for a big plumbing job: confirm the scope with a camera before you price anything. From there, weigh trenchless against total restoration cost and pick materials suited to your climate.
